Abstract
一种太阳能热水器水箱包括:外壳、外壳内的保温层和保温层内的内胆及进、出水口;内胆内设置至少二块隔板,隔板将内胆分隔成若干部分,隔板具有将两相邻内胆腔连通的开孔。所述两相邻隔板的开孔最好上、下错位设置,与水箱进水孔同腔的隔板开孔最好设于隔板的较高处。使得进入下一腔体的水在该腔体中的温度相对较高,利于保持出水口水温稳定。
A water tank for a solar water heater comprises: an outer shell, an insulating layer in the outer shell, an inner container in the insulating layer, and water inlets and outlets; at least two partitions are arranged in the inner container, the partitions divide the inner container into several parts, and the partitions have The opening that connects two adjacent inner tank cavities. The openings of the two adjacent partitions are preferably arranged in a dislocation up and down, and the openings of the partitions in the same cavity as the water inlet hole of the water tank are preferably arranged at a higher position of the partitions. The temperature of the water entering the next cavity is relatively high in the cavity, which is beneficial to keep the water temperature at the water outlet stable.
Description
技术领域:Technical field:
本实用新型涉及太阳能热水器技术领域,特别涉及一种太阳能热水器水箱。The utility model relates to the technical field of solar water heaters, in particular to a solar water heater water tank.
背景技术:Background technique:
目前,在承压式太阳能热水器水箱技术领域,热水器内的热水流出时,整个水箱内水温下降较大。中国专利99229356.1号为解决该问题提出了一种“太阳能热水器卧式水箱”。其在内胆内设置隔板将内胆隔成左右两部分,隔板一侧设有导流装置。该技术方案可以部分解决水温大面积下降的问题,但其效果不很理想。再者,由于在隔板上安装导流装置,结构复杂、制造也不方便。At present, in the field of pressurized solar water heater water tank technology, when the hot water in the water heater flows out, the water temperature in the whole water tank drops greatly. Chinese patent No. 99229356.1 has proposed a kind of " solar water heater horizontal water tank " for solving this problem. A partition is arranged in the inner tank to divide the inner tank into left and right parts, and a flow guide device is arranged on one side of the partition. This technical scheme can partly solve the problem that the water temperature drops in a large area, but its effect is not very satisfactory. Furthermore, since the flow guiding device is installed on the dividing plate, the structure is complicated and the manufacture is also inconvenient.
发明内容:Invention content:
发明人针对以上缺陷,提出了一种使用时出水水温较稳定、结构合理的太阳能热水器水箱。其包括:外壳、外壳内的保温层和保温层内的内胆及进、出水口;内胆内设置至少二块隔板,隔板将内胆分隔成若干部分,隔板具有将两相邻内胆腔连通的开孔。在使用时,补充进来的冷水将热水上抬,并通过开孔进入下一腔体中,进入下一腔体中的水与该腔体中的热水混合后再进入另一个腔体,如此多次重复,使得热水器出水口在使用时出水水温稳定。由于内胆中设有多个隔板,可以大大提高水箱内胆的承压强度。In view of the above defects, the inventor proposes a solar water heater water tank with relatively stable outlet water temperature and reasonable structure during use. It includes: the outer shell, the insulation layer in the outer shell, the liner in the heat preservation layer, and the water inlet and outlet; at least two partitions are arranged in the liner, and the partition divides the liner into several parts. Openings through which the inner cavity communicates. When in use, the added cold water lifts the hot water up and enters the next cavity through the opening. The water entering the next cavity mixes with the hot water in this cavity before entering another cavity. Repeating so many times makes the outlet water temperature stable when the outlet of the water heater is in use. Since the inner tank is provided with a plurality of dividing plates, the pressure bearing strength of the inner tank of the water tank can be greatly improved.
在本实用新型中,所述两相邻隔板的开孔最好上、下错位设置,与水箱进水孔同腔的隔板开孔最好设于隔板的较高处。使得进入下一腔体的水在该腔体中的温度相对较高,利于保持出水口水温稳定。In the utility model, the openings of the two adjacent partitions are preferably set up and down in a dislocation manner, and the openings of the partitions with the same cavity as the water inlet hole of the water tank are preferably arranged at a higher position of the partitions. The temperature of the water entering the next cavity in this cavity is relatively high, which is beneficial to keep the water temperature of the water outlet stable.
在本实用新型中,所述的两相邻隔板可将水箱相对分成导流腔和容水腔,构成导流腔的两相邻隔板间距最好相对较小,构成容水腔的两相邻隔板间距最好相对较大,利于安装集热管,同时利于保持出水口水温稳定。In the present utility model, the two adjacent partitions can relatively divide the water tank into a diversion chamber and a water holding chamber. The distance between adjacent partitions is preferably relatively large, which is conducive to the installation of heat collecting tubes, and at the same time is conducive to maintaining a stable water temperature at the water outlet.

具体实施方式:Detailed ways:
如图1、图2所示,一种太阳能热水器水箱包括:外壳1、外壳内的保温层2和保温层内的内胆3及进水口4、出水口5;内胆内设有六块隔板6,隔板将内胆分隔成七个部分,隔板具有将两相邻内胆腔连通的开孔7。两相邻隔板的开孔上、下错位设置,与水箱进水孔同腔的隔板开孔设于隔板的较高处。两相邻隔板可将水箱相对分成导流腔8和容水腔9,构成导流腔的两相邻隔板间距相对较小,构成容水腔的两相邻隔板间距相对较大。As shown in Figure 1 and Figure 2, a solar water heater water tank includes: a shell 1, an
如图1虚线所示,在使用时,补充进来的冷水与第一腔体内的热水混合后,通过开孔和导流腔进入下一腔体中,进入下一腔体中的水与该腔体中的热水混合后再进入另一个腔体,如此多次重复,使得水箱出水口出水水温稳定。同时可以提高水箱内胆的承压强度。As shown by the dotted line in Figure 1, when in use, the added cold water is mixed with the hot water in the first cavity, and then enters the next cavity through the opening and the diversion cavity, and the water that enters the next cavity is mixed with the hot water in the first cavity. The hot water in the cavity is mixed and then enters another cavity, and this is repeated many times, so that the temperature of the water at the outlet of the water tank is stable. At the same time, the pressure bearing strength of the water tank liner can be improved.
